Surgical masks offer some form of protection! Would they stop you from getting infected in a high risk environment? Probably not but if everyone wears surgical masks, asymptomatic people wouldn’t be going about infecting people because it stops droplets from flying about.

South Korea, Japan, China,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Singapore ... and yes their numbers may be increasing but they’re definitely not going through the hell the US, Spain, Italy, UK ... who have been told this rubbish about face masks because they didn’t want people hoarding them and wanted them to be available for healthcare workers who need them the most. This was the main reason they recommended that people not wear masks, also at the time they thought only symptomatic people spread the virus which isn’t the case.

Travel / Re: Nigerians Abroad, How Do You Cope With The Coronavirus Issue? by CptCharlesVane: 9:23pm On Mar 23, 2020
Normal day with nice weather here in NYC, now the epicenter of the Coronavirus in the US. I stay in most of the time, people are aware and keep a distance even when walking on the across the street and more people wearing masks. ‘Essential’ stores are still open with limited times with signs and warnings about Covid-19.

It’s projected to get much worse with the numbers, especially now with the more aggressive testing, and hoping in two weeks the numbers would sort of stabilize. Yet, somehow more worried about my family in Nigeria dealing with the virus situation, especially my parents.

Staying safe, you should too.
